Present Subjunctive of German verb treiben
The conjugation of treiben (drift, float) in subjunctive I is: ich treibe, du treibest, er treibe, wir treiben, ihr treibet, sie treiben. The endings -e, -est, -e, -en, -et, -en are appended to the base or verb stem treib. The conjugation of these forms conforms to the grammatical rules for verbs in the subjunctive I tense.

Verb forms in Present Subjunctive of treiben
The verb treiben fully conjugated in all persons and numbers in the Subjunctive Present
Subjunctive PresentForm of possibility
- ich treibe (1st PersonSingular)
- du treibest (2nd PersonSingular)
- er treibe (3rd PersonSingular)
- wir treiben (1st PersonPlural)
- ihr treibet (2nd PersonPlural)
- sie treiben (3rd PersonPlural)
